Why purify MEDA liquid?

MEDA is used in a wide range of gas treatment applications. In the petroleum industry, it is used as an absorbent for acid gases such as carbon dioxide and hydrogen sulfide. Compared to conventional desulphurization agents - MEDA has good adsorption properties for H2S.
However, in the process of desulphurization with MEDA solution, when the gas is absorbed, it may react chemically with methyl diethanolamine, forming bubbles and leading to foaming phenomena, which in severe cases can cause massive loss of amine solution due to fog-end entrainment, greatly reducing the purification effect and even making the unit unable to produce normally. Therefore, it is necessary to purify and treat the methyl diethanolamine properly in order to remove impurities that may cause foaming.

Role of Activated Carbon in Purifying MEDA

In order to reduce the problem of foaming, the used MDA is treated through a bed of activated carbon, which allows for purification and regeneration.
The absorption mechanism of activated carbon is the adsorption of organic matter in solution through the pore structure on the surface and chemisorption. When treating methylenedioethanolamine through an activated carbon bed, the pore structure of the activated carbon is able to adsorb and remove impurities and contaminants from it, restoring the methylenedioethanolamine to a high purity.

Parameters of Activated Carbon for Amine Purification

coal granular activated carbon amine filtration
Size
8x30 mesh, 8x16 mesh
Iodine Number
950mg/g(min.)
Molasses Number
200(min.)
Abrasion Numaber
75
Moisture Content
2%
Bed Density
460kg/m³
Surface Area(N2BET metod)
950㎡/g
Hardness
95%(min)

Few Points in Amine Purification

1. Appropriate activated carbon selection: Select an activated carbon material with appropriate adsorption characteristics depending on the type and concentration of contaminants in the MDA.
2. Adjustment of the treatment conditions: adjustment of parameters such as flow rate, temperature, and contact time to obtain the best adsorption effect.
3. Activated carbon regeneration: As the adsorption capacity of activated carbon decreases, the activated carbon needs to be regenerated or replaced.
By using activated carbon for the purification of MDA, impurities and contaminants can be effectively removed from it, restoring MDA to a high level of purity for re-use in areas where it is needed.
